Quarterly Planning Note — Bravance Term Sheet

For department heads. Bravance Systems returned a revised term sheet Tuesday. Key points: three-year exclusivity on the Ostrel platform, volume floors starting at 40k units, co-marketing fund capped at 6% of net revenue. Legal flags the termination clause as one-sided; Finance wants the payment schedule shortened. Counterproposal drafts due Friday. No external discussion until signature. Negotiation posture and fallback positions are summarised in the confidential note appended directly below.

confidential, hahap-taweg: Headcount on the Zorath team goes from 7 to 140 by the end of January. Gross margin on Zorath came in at 15 percent against a plan of 20 percent.

Account recovery — Almsletter receipt mailer: First confirm the affected donor record in the Greywick console shows a bounced receipt, not a suppressed one. Re-verify the sending identity, then rotate the mailer's signing credentials via the recovery flow. The flow will pause and prompt for the vault recovery passphrase, which is:

vault phrase of bagaf-kajeg = jorath-feniel-briir-siliel-ralix

Hey Priya — handing off the Lintwood build migration. Most targets now compile under the hermetic toolchain; only the codegen step still leaks host paths. If CI goes red, rerun with the sandbox flag before panicking. Everything else is steady. The current service configuration values are listed below.

settings of tajep-tafog:
CASDOR_LOG_LEVEL=info
CASDOR_METRICS_HOST=metrics.casdor.nelvrosys.internal
CASDOR_POOL_SIZE=16